Earl Stephenson Kenney, 79, died Tuesday, October 22, 2002 in Cedar City, UT.

He was born on May 19, 1923 in Fillmore, UT to Vilate Stephenson and Benjamin Glen Kenney. He married Judith Ann Williams in the St. George Temple on June 5, 1946. She preceded him in death by seven months.

Earl is survived by his children, Ann (Clyne) Long, serving a mission in Ecuador, Lloyd Earl (Lynda) Kenney of Cedar City, UT, Bonnie Ruth (Joseph) Stott of Richfield, UT, Mark Glen (Teri) Kenney of Cedar City, UT, Karma (Stuart) Bailey of Fillmore, UT, Mary Ellen (Joseph) Larkin of Salt Lake City, UT; 24 grandchildren; nine great-grandchildren; brothers, Mont G. (Margaret) Kenney of Salt Lake City, UT, Blair S. (Joan) Kenney of Redlands, CA, and Karl Benjamin (Alene) Kenney of Holladay, UT. He was preceded in death by his wife; parents; sisters, Nana Kenney Roberts, Veda Ellen Kenney Adams; two grandsons, Adam Mark Kenney and Brent Lloyd Kenney.

Funeral services will be held Monday, October 28, 2002, at 1:00 p.m. in the Cedar Heritage Chapel, 290 W. 1045 N. Friends may call Sunday, October 27, 2002, from 6:00 to 8:00 p.m. at Southern Utah Mortuary, 190 N. 300 W. and on Monday, October 28, 2002, from 11:30 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. at the church. Interment will be in the Cedar City Cemetery.
